About us

The Michigan Indigent Defense Commission (MIDC) was created by legislation in 2013 after an advisory commission recommended improvements to the state’s legal system. The MIDC will work to ensure the state’s public defense system is fair, cost-effective and constitutional while simultaneously protecting public safety and accountability.
